The first step in setting up your Chromecast is to connect it to your TV. To do this, you'll need to plug the Chromecast into an available HDMI port on the back of your TV.

Once plugged in, you'll need to select the correct input on your TV so that the Chromecast can be seen. Once the Chromecast is connected to your TV, you'll need to download the Google Home app. This app will help you set up your Chromecast and manage its settings. Once downloaded, open the app and follow the instructions to connect your device.

Once connected, you'll be able to start streaming video from various services such as Netflix, Hulu, YouTube, and more. To do this, simply open the app for the service you want to stream and tap the “cast” icon. This will allow you to stream video from the app directly onto your TV. Connecting Your Chromecast

Connecting your Chromecast device to your TV is easy and straightforward. Start by connecting the Chromecast device to the HDMI port on your TV. Make sure that your TV is powered on and the correct input is selected. Once you have connected the Chromecast to the HDMI port, plug the power cord into an outlet.

The Chromecast will power up and show a welcome screen. Now you can connect the Chromecast to your home Wi-Fi network. On your mobile device, launch the Google Home app and select the setup option. From here, you can select the Wi-Fi network and enter the password.

Once connected, your Chromecast will be ready to use.

Customizing Settings

Once you have connected your Chromecast device to your TV, you can start customizing the various settings within the Google Home app. The app will allow you to change the device name, adjust parental controls, and more. Here's a step-by-step guide on how to customize your Chromecast settings.

Step 1: Open the Google Home app

First, open the Google Home app on your mobile device.

You can download it from the App Store or Google Play.

Step 2: Select your Chromecast device

Once the app is open, select your Chromecast device from the list of available devices. If you have multiple Chromecast devices, make sure to select the one that is connected to your TV.

Step 3: Customize your settings

Once you have selected your device, you can start customizing the various settings. Here are some of the options you can adjust in the Google Home app:
  • Device name: Change the name of your Chromecast device from the default name.
  • Parental controls: Set up parental controls to limit what content can be streamed.
  • Guest mode: Enable guest mode so that anyone on your Wi-Fi network can stream content without having to log in.
  • Backdrop: Choose what type of content to display when the Chromecast is idle.
